Abstract
The invention discloses a kind of fine powder weight bag automatic feeding metering filling and packing system and its control method, belong to metering packing technical field, system includes:General supply and high power load switch board, systemic-function switch board, Weighing control cabinet and display screen;The output end of the first programmable controller in systemic-function switch board is connected with the servomotor group in general supply and high power load switch board, and the input of the first programmable controller is connected with display screen;First programmable controller is also connected progress two-way communication with Weighing control cabinet;Two power supplys in general supply and high power load switch board are connected with systemic-function switch board and Weighing control cabinet respectively.The control method that a kind of superfine powder weight bag automatic feeding measures filling and packing system is also provided.Whole superfine powder weight bag flow package is controlled using advanced programmable controller, electrically integral Automated condtrol is realized, the efficiency of the gentle superfine powder packaging of Automated water of superfine powder weight bag packaging is improved.

Embodiment
With reference to shown in Fig. 1 to Fig. 2, the present invention is described in further detail.
As shown in figure 1, present embodiment discloses a kind of superfine powder weight bag automatic feeding metering filling and packing system, the system
Including:
General supply and high power load switch board 10, systemic-function switch board 20, Weighing control cabinet 30 and display screen 40;
The output end of the first programmable controller 21 in systemic-function switch board 20 and general supply and high power load control
Servomotor group 11 in cabinet 10 processed is connected, and the input of the first programmable controller 21 is connected with display screen 40;
First programmable controller 21 is also connected progress two-way communication with Weighing control cabinet 30;
Two power supplys 12 in general supply and high power load switch board 10 are respectively with systemic-function switch board 20 and claiming
Weight switch board 30 is connected.
Further, the first programmable controller 21 is connected by detection switch or magnetic valve with executing agency group 50;
Described executing agency's group 50 includes first, second armful of band mechanism, grasping mechanism and bag taking mechanism.
Further, the servomotor group in general supply and high power load switch board 10 includes first, second conveying electricity
Machine, feed bleed motor, bleed motor and armful band translation motor.
It should be noted that the motor in the present embodiment uses high-precision servo motor, it is ensured that feed it is steady,
Coordinate Automatic Weight Measure System, it is ensured that the precision of packaging and the accuracy weighed.
Further, the output end of the first programmable controller 21 passes sequentially through servo-driver, auxiliary reclay and change
Frequency device is connected with servomotor group 11;
The output end of first programmable controller 21 is also connected with transformer.
It should be noted that controlling transformer to seal packaging bag by programmable controller 21.
Further, as shown in figure 1, Weighing control cabinet 30 includes the second programmable controller 31 and Weighing module 32;
The input of Weighing module 32 is connected with the pressure sensor installed in Weighing mechanism bottom by middleboxes, exported
End is connected with the input of the second programmable controller 31;
Second programmable controller 31 is connected progress two-way communication with the first programmable controller 21.
Specifically, four pressure sensors are installed in Weighing mechanism bottom even in the present embodiment.Weighing process is specially:
Weighing module 32 during no placement packaging bag, goes out to weigh on Weighing mechanism according to the buckling signal of change of now sensor transmissions
The weight of mechanism;After packaging bag is placed on Weighing mechanism, Weighing module 32 is according to the buckling signal meters of now sensor transmissions
Calculate the weight of now Weighing mechanism;The weight of the Weighing mechanism measured twice is subtracted each other, you can obtain after filling superfine powder
The weight of packaging bag.
Specifically, idiographic flow when being packed using the system disclosed in the present embodiment is:
(1) system detectio in bag storehouse whether marsupial, confirm storehouse in marsupial when, Programmable Logic Controller Control System perform take
Bag, vacuum produce, drag bag, upset packaging bag operation;
(2) Programmable Logic Controller Control System performs folder bag to empty bag, opens the operations such as bag, blanking be logical, then programmable control
Device processed output blanking request, Weighing control cabinet starts to control corresponding equipment to start blanking to go forward side by side the real weight detecting of behaviour, reach
After the gravimetric value of setting, Weighing control cabinet is automatically stopped blanking and drives big packing machine to carry out necking, sealing, embrace bag, conveying etc.
Action;
(3) the vacuum forming action repeated to the packaging bag filled with superfine powder, and to bag after packaging bag forming
Pack is packed.
As shown in Fig. 2 present embodiment discloses the control that a kind of superfine powder weight bag automatic feeding measures filling and packing system
Method, comprises the following steps S1 to S3:
S1, by display screen 40 control parameter is inputted to the first programmable controller 21;
S2, the first programmable controller 21 export corresponding control signal according to the control parameter received and control general supply
And the servomotor group 11 in high power load switch board 10 carries out charge to packaging bag;
S3, the first programmable controller 21 export corresponding control signal according to the control parameter received and control control of weighing
Cabinet 20 processed is weighed to the packaging bag after charge.
Further, the first programmable controller 21 exports corresponding control signal according to the control parameter received and controlled
Executing agency's group 50 is acted to control packaging bag to move.
Further, step S2 is specifically included:
First programmable controller 21 exports corresponding control signal according to the control parameter of input and controls bag taking mechanism to take
Packaging bag;
Packaging bag is delivered to station 1 by the first conveying motor, and packaging bag is performed in station 1 by feed bleed motor
Feed, air suction process;
After the completion of feed, air suction process, grasping mechanism packaging bag is captured and transfer to first armful band mechanism so that
First armful of band mechanism embraces packaging bag to station 2;
Bleed motor performs air suction process at station 2 to the packaging bag after charge, and will be packed by the grasping mechanism
Second armful of band mechanism is transferred to after bag crawl;
Packaging bag is embraced by second armful of band mechanism is sealed to station 3, and at station 3 by transformer to packaging bag;
After the completion of packaging bag enclosing action, the packaging bag after sealing transferred into the second conveying motor with translation motor by embracing
Conveyed.
It should be noted that in actual applications, the overhead idle of station 1, the packaging bag that grasping mechanism captures sky again is entered
Row filling, then moves to station 2, station 3, so circulation, improves packaging efficiency.
Further, step S3 is specifically included:
Weighing module 32 receives the buckling signal of sensor transmissions by middleboxes and sends the buckling signal received
To the second programmable controller 31;
The buckling signal that second 31 pairs of programmable controller is received is handled, and obtains the weight of the packaging bag after charge
Amount, and the weight information of the packaging bag after charge is sent to the first programmable controller 21.
Further, the first programmable controller 21 also receives the fault message of servo-driver transmission according to failure to be believed
Breath judges whether the motor in servo-driver or servomotor group breaks down.
Further, the first programmable controller 21 judges the executing agency in executing agency's group 50 by detection switch
In place whether action.
It should be noted that servomotor is weighed after running into emergency situations jerk in the process of running it is undesirable that powering off
Open, enable can be used to reset to reset servomotor, restPosed after a reset with unification key origin.
It should also be noted that, must be triggered opening bag packaging function before folder bag starts, if processed in folder bag
A bag packaging function is opened in journey, then it is invalid to be considered as, next circulation is effective.
Specifically, the control parameter inputted in system disclosed in the present embodiment is specifically included:
Marsupial bag taking is delayed:Detect after marsupial, be delayed bag taking.
Bag taking vacuum is kept:Vacuum time is opened in bag taking afterwards in place, execution next step action after the time reaches.
The bag delay of bag taking support:Delay support bag action when bag taking return starts.
Arrange bag and hold up delay:Delay row's bag picking-up action when weighing system blanking starts.
Locate the delay of necking cylinder:Open delay necking cylinder action after bag vacuum is opened.
Take off a bag cylinder delay:Open delay after bag vacuum is reached and take off a bag cylinder action.
Blanking pulsewidth length:Blanking request signal pulse width.
It is evacuated backhaul height:Bleed motor reaches the time height gone up after lower limit.
Folder bag unclamps bag delay:Embrace delay after folder bag action and unclamp 1# folder bag magnetic valves.
Feed vacuumizes delay:Delay vacuumizes action when weighing system blanking starts.
The continuous vacuum time of feed:Duration is vacuumized after the completion of weighing system blanking.
Blowback is delayed after vacuum:Continue delay after the completion of vacuumizing and perform blowback action.
The blowback time after vacuum:Blowback delay performs blowback time span after arriving.
Loose metal is delayed after blowback:The bleed motor that is delayed after the completion of blowback is depressed into position.
Backhaul starts motor delay:Delayed startup bleed motor rises to upper limit after the completion of loose metal.
Backhaul starts blowback delay:Delayed startup blowback is acted after the completion of loose metal.
Backhaul starts the blowback time:Blowback action delay, which is reached, performs the blowback time.
Blanking barrel shakes the time:The vibrations time is opened after the completion of blanking.
Sealing cylinder is delayed:Embrace bag conveyer and reach delay execution sealing cylinder action after No. three station.
The sealing cylinder time:Sealing cylinder delay time performs sealing action after reaching.
Sealing heating delay:Embrace bag conveyer and reach delay execution heating action after No. three station.
Seal the heat time:Heat after delay time is reached and perform heating actuation time.
Last time of delivery:Set out after stop button, material is sent packing machine required time length by No. three station.
